首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JQuery悬停更改边框和鼠标离开问题

是一个涉及前端开发的问题。下面是一个完善且全面的答案:

JQuery是一个广泛应用于前端开发的JavaScript库,它简化了JavaScript代码的编写,并提供了丰富的功能和特性。在悬停更改边框和鼠标离开问题中,我们可以使用JQuery来实现这个效果。

首先,我们需要为需要悬停更改边框的元素添加一个CSS类,例如"hover-border"。然后,我们可以使用JQuery的hover()方法来监听鼠标悬停和离开事件,并在事件发生时添加或移除CSS类。

下面是一个示例代码:

HTML代码:

代码语言:txt
复制
<div class="hover-border">这是一个示例元素</div>

CSS代码:

代码语言:txt
复制
.hover-border {
  border: 1px solid #000;
}

.hover-border.hover {
  border-color: #f00;
}

JavaScript代码(使用JQuery):

代码语言:txt
复制
$(document).ready(function() {
  $(".hover-border").hover(
    function() {
      $(this).addClass("hover");
    },
    function() {
      $(this).removeClass("hover");
    }
  );
});

在上述代码中,我们使用了JQuery的hover()方法来监听元素的鼠标悬停和离开事件。当鼠标悬停在元素上时,会触发第一个函数,即添加CSS类"hover";当鼠标离开元素时,会触发第二个函数,即移除CSS类"hover"。

这样,当鼠标悬停在具有"hover-border"类的元素上时,边框颜色会变为红色;当鼠标离开时,边框颜色会恢复为黑色。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供灵活可扩展的云服务器实例,适用于各种应用场景。详细信息请参考:腾讯云云服务器
  • 腾讯云云数据库MySQL版:提供高性能、可扩展的云数据库服务,适用于各种规模的应用。详细信息请参考:腾讯云云数据库MySQL版
  • 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于存储和管理各种类型的数据。详细信息请参考:腾讯云对象存储
  • 腾讯云人工智能平台(AI Lab):提供丰富的人工智能服务和工具,帮助开发者构建智能化应用。详细信息请参考:腾讯云人工智能平台
  • 腾讯云物联网平台(IoT Hub):提供全面的物联网解决方案,帮助连接和管理物联网设备。详细信息请参考:腾讯云物联网平台
  • 腾讯云区块链服务(Tencent Blockchain):提供安全可信赖的区块链服务,帮助构建和管理区块链应用。详细信息请参考:腾讯云区块链服务
  • 腾讯云视频处理(VOD):提供高效便捷的视频处理和管理服务,适用于各种视频应用场景。详细信息请参考:腾讯云视频处理
  • 腾讯云音视频通信(TRTC):提供稳定高质量的音视频通信服务,适用于实时音视频通信应用。详细信息请参考:腾讯云音视频通信
  • 腾讯云云原生应用引擎(Tencent Serverless Framework):提供无服务器架构的应用开发和部署框架,简化开发流程。详细信息请参考:腾讯云云原生应用引擎
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券